Renting out a mid-century modern home requires a strategic approach to attract tenants who appreciate the unique style and features of this architectural era. Proper presentation and targeted marketing can help find tenants who will value and care for the property.
Highlighting the Unique Features
Mid-century modern homes are known for their clean lines, open floor plans, and large windows. When advertising the property, emphasize these features through high-quality photos and detailed descriptions. Showcasing the original design elements, such as built-in furniture or distinctive lighting fixtures, can attract enthusiasts of this style.
Preparing the Home for Viewings
Ensure the home is clean, well-maintained, and free of clutter. Consider staging the space with modern furniture that complements the home's style. Proper lighting and neutral decor can help prospective tenants envision living there. Highlighting the functional aspects, like updated appliances or energy-efficient windows, can also be appealing.
Marketing Strategies
Use online platforms and social media to reach a broad audience. Include detailed descriptions and high-quality images in listings. Target audiences interested in architecture, design, or those seeking a distinctive living space. Hosting open houses can also generate interest among serious applicants.
Attracting the Right Tenants
Screen tenants carefully to ensure they appreciate the home's style and are capable of maintaining it. Look for tenants with a history of responsible renting and good references. Clear communication about the property's unique features and expectations can help attract tenants who will value the home.
